Trina Stewart Rapping Baby December 12, 2011 3 Comments Ellen Degeneres Shares the Amazing Rapping Baby Video What can I say besides Ellen says it all!!
Trina Stewart Rapping Baby December 12, 2011 3 Comments Ellen Degeneres Shares the Amazing Rapping Baby Video What can I say besides Ellen says it all!!